Jaw Tenderizer

The Jaw Tenderizer was a set of brass knuckles found in London during the 19th century.

Basic in their design, consisting of a piece of wood with nails sticking out, the knuckles were found by the British Assassins Evie and Jacob Frye in a chest within the Cannon Street station of the City of London.[1]
